It was perfection from Piastri with a pole position that Monique watched from the Paddock Club. The oldest F1 track in the Middle East delivered excitement with plenty of overtaking action, penalties galore, an opportune safety car, a DNF, and a disqualification. The (mostly) two stop race had drivers on different strategies and different tyres, with some teams not learning the lessons from others when tyres didn't fire up.
Mon, in situ, recording from a luxe over-water bungalow and Di from a new home office studio, chat about Formula 1’s new global sponsor which Di welcomes but Mon finds polarising.
Monique shares some insights into Bahraini culture that seems to be a far cry from the Middle Eastern stereotypes. And she shares her Paddock Club experience, the re-wilding of the Hawa Islands and the culinary delights of Bahrain. Plus picking up a free and unusual souvenir.
The Bahrain Formula 1 Grand Prix reminds us why we love F1 so much.
